Output ef6578c8bacda61b19f2421f757a58103ec08b261172187cc29513d63bca65d6:2

value
51520897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a83086e6c5b497ff0b6bc56e9233565bfc0cd32 OP_EQUAL
address
MAKLmkCp4pDuzpP8Bc8Xosq4PgbYrShBd5
transaction
ef6578c8bacda61b19f2421f757a58103ec08b261172187cc29513d63bca65d6
spent
true